With a voice in his chest, a guitar on his shoulders, and a band behind his back, Rhett Repko only has one goal: to bring his influences of timeless classics into today's modern music scene. "Music has the ability to deliver raw unfiltered emotions from one person to another." Rhett goes on to say, "Records today tend to be produced to perfection, but those aren't the ones we love.”

Rhett found his place in the world at 15 when he took a guitar class in high school. In love with his new passion, Rhett turned to the music of the Beatles where the unusual chord changes and heart-felt harmonies and lyrics fueled his deep love affair with music and sealed his desire to become a songwriter.  Along the way, he became inspired with the magical productions of George Martin for the Beatles, and then later Butch Vig’s brilliant work on Nirvana’s Nevermind.  

Rhett studied production under Alan Wonneberger at UMBC, where he earned his BA in Music, and also formed his band.  What makes this band different is that they never leave the studio. With a certain sound in his head, Rhett works endlessly and is and determined in getting his vision to blast out of speakers by producing his own recordings. A mix of retro and modern techniques drives Rhett to deliver the best of both worlds.  

But in the end, for Rhett, “It’s about the song. Is it good enough? Does it make you feel something? It’s not about fame. It’s about the struggle to be understood.  Isn’t that what music is all about?”  


Rhett has been recognized by the International Song Of The Year Songwriting Contest as a Semi-Finalist for his rock song "A Little Loving" in July and "About Last Night" in December of 2016.

Rhett also earned a Top 20 Finalist spot for his song "Say Goodbye" in the SongBuilder Studios Songwriting Competition in December of 2016.
